This guide focuses on Simple Hammers v1.0.1, a lightweight mod for Minecraft (primarily Fabric). It is designed to speed up mining by allowing you to break blocks in a 3x3 area. Core Mechanics
3x3 Area Mining: Hammers function like pickaxes but break a 3x3x1 area of blocks around the central block you strike.
Precision Mode: Hold Shift (Sneak) while mining to break only a single block at a time for precision work.
Tool Tiers: Like standard tools, hammers come in various material tiers (Wood, Stone, Iron, Gold, Diamond, and Netherite). simple hammers v101 bp hot
Durability Cost: Breaking a full 3x3 area typically consumes 9 durability points (one for each block) unless you have the Unbreaking enchantment. Crafting & Upgrades
Hammers are typically crafted using a modified version of the standard pickaxe recipe:
Recipe: Usually requires two sticks and five of the tier material (e.g., 5 iron ingots).
Enchantments: Standard mining enchantments like Efficiency, Unbreaking, Fortune, and Silk Touch apply to all blocks in the 3x3 area. Pro Tips for Efficiency
Mining Spawners: The mod is balanced to prevent accidentally destroying rare blocks; for example, it will break surrounding stone but not a Mob Spawner or Ancient Debris.
Directional Mining: The orientation of the 3x3 break depends on the face of the block you hit. If you change direction while holding the mine button, you may need to release and tap again to update the mining orientation.
